1. I am often told by CS that I need to "connect x ressource to my trade network". To my very best knowledge that is often already the case - the actual tile is being worked and I have roads between my cities. Is the quest actually that the CS requesting this is not connected ? And will it help building a road to them (which often is a seperate quest)

First, connecting resources to your trading network has nothing to do with roads or whether you are currently "working" that tile -- all that matters is that you have used a worker to improve a tile that has that resource (e.g., for an iron tile, a mine; for an ivory tile, a camp, etc.).

There are two screens you need to become facile with. The first is Citizen Management in the City View screen -- that tells you what tiles your city's citizens are "working", which determines what tiles you are receiving tile yields on. This is entirely separate from what tiles your worker units are improving. To connect a resource, you need to improve that tile with a worker. Separately, to obtain the tile yield (from an improved or unimproved tile), a citizen must be assigned to "work" that tile.

The other key screen is the resources screen (top left menu, which normally shows what tech you are researching, drops down to display other options, including a resource listing). If you get a "connect resource" CS quest, check the resources screen -- often you will find that you have traded away all of your copies of that resource (in which case the quest will be fulfilled when that trade expires and a copy of that resource returns to you) -- but you may also find that you haven't improved a tile with that resource (in which case, get your worker hopping) -- and sometimes you will find that you don't have any of those resource tiles in your empire, in which case your only options are to trade for that resource, ally with another CS that has an improved copy of that resource, or conquer a city that has an improved copy of that resource.

3. In connection to my question above I have sometimes accepted the trade (checking if the luxury ressource is available by removing it from the trade screen to make sure it becomes available on my side). If it is available I usually accept the trade instead so I get something for the vacant ressource. The problem is that more than a few times this has resulted in unhappiness by appr. 4 persons - and once I completed 3 trades in a single round with other AI's and ended up with -8 in happiness from positive. I find that strange since that should only happen if I give away ressources that is being used by my own people and I don't believe that is the case - but not sure ?

Yeah, you don't want to trade away your last copy of a luxury (lose 4 happiness per unique luxury). Also, there is a long-standing display bug that mis-states the number of remaining copies of a luxury you have when a trade is initiated by the AI. Best course is to deny the trade and hop over to the Resources tab to confirm and then re-initiate the trade on your turn.

4. Playing as Babylonians I get a lot of free GP scientists. What is normally recommended - to use all for the improvement with the same city (so perhaps ending up with 5-8 with the same city) or using these for multiple cities ?

First, you should only plant GSs to form academies in cities that have maximum science bonuses -- usually that is the city in which you built your National College (+50% science in that city). Even better with an observatory (another +50%). In terms of numbers, Babs will generate more GSs, so you can afford a few more academies, but in general, after the first one or two academies, you should generally save GSs until later in the game. A GS bulbed for science will generate beakers equal to your last 8 turns of beaker production, so it is best done at least 8 turns after you have in place the other science multipliers (research labs, observatories, various Ratoinalism policies). There is strategy about precisely how and when to bulb GSs, but that is the jist.

5. When using the GP scientist for the improvement do I get the science bonus immediately or will it only count when the tile is being worked ? I sometimes find it hard to decide if I should use the GP on the location that my advisor suggests ? Will any ressources go to waste if they are on the tile or will the improvement come on top of that ?

You only receive yield from tiles that are worked by your citizens -- consult Citizen Management in the City View screen. Also, if you plant a Great person (any Great person, not just GSs) on a tile, any improvement that is already on that tile (farm, mine, pasture, camp, etc.) is eliminated and you receive that tiles base yield plus the Great Person tile improvement yield .
